Configuring flow sampling

Perform this task to configure flow sampling on an Ethernet interface. The sFlow agent samples
packets on that interface according to the configured parameters, encapsulates them into sFlow
packets, and sends them in UDP packets to the specified sFlow collector.
To configure flow sampling:

Remarks
N/A
Optional.
Not specified by default. The device periodically
checks whether the sFlow agent has an IP address. If
the sFlow agent has no IP address configured, the
device automatically selects an interface IP address
for the sFlow agent but does not save the IP address.
NOTE:
Hewlett Packard Enterprise recommends that
you manually configure an IP address for the
sFlow agent.
Only one IP address can be specified for the
sFlow agent on the device.
By default, the device presets a certain number of
sFlow collectors.
Use display sflow to display the parameters of the
preset sFlow collectors.
Optional.
Not specified by default.
